How to Clone a Plan

Clone a plan to copy its details, premiums, documents, and related settings into a new plan in Plans. Cloning a plan does not create or clone benefit subgroups—see Cloning Benefit Subgroups for that.

Who can clone a plan

Employers with Benefits can clone plans. Global Admins working as the employer can as well. Benefits Feature Admins can open Subgroups under Benefits, but they do not have access to clone plans from Plans.

To clone a plan:
  1. Select Benefits in the top navigation.
  2. Select Plans.
  3. Open the cog menu for the plan you want to clone.
  4. Select Clone.
Selecting Clone creates the new plan immediately and opens its Configure tab. The cloned plan is already listed under Plans. Adjust details on Configure or Premiums as needed, then select Save changes.

The plan you clone must already have rates. If it does not, BerniePortal shows Please fill in plan rates before cloning a plan. and opens the Premiums tab for that plan.
